    As I've mentioned, this will be my first time using the Maestro thingy. Currently I have the stock Nav HU run through the stock wire harness to an Alpine 5 channel amp and the to the speakers trough the stock wire harness from the Alpine and of course seperate wires to the sub.
    I will be running RCAs this time, but the Maestro supposedly "keeps" the stock amp. Do I just not bother connecting the speaker outputs from the new HU to the Maestro, or hook them up anyways and let the new ilx-f500 figure it out? I also am guessing that I will lose my dash speakers as they are powered by the stock HU without any help from the amp, although this isn't a big deal.

    Just run the Maestro harness as-is and it’ll let the HU keep powering the front speakers, assuming you want to keep them. Run RCAs to your amp using the pre-out harness included with the Alpine. There’s a dedicated port on the back of your alpine for it.

    Satellite Radio

    In order to add or retain SiriusXM satellite radio, you are required to purchase the "SiriusXM SXV300V1 Tuner" at a cost of $70 US. Typically there are promotions that essentially negate the cost of the physical tuner.

    If you vehicle is equipped with a functioning SAT Antenna, you can utilize the antenna adapter that is included with the Maestro ACC-SAT-T02.

    If your vehicle is not equipped with a functioning SAT Antenna, you will have to utilize the SAT antenna that is included with the aforementioned tuner.
